Lander University vs. Daymar College-Bowling Green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Lander University or Daymar College-Bowling Green?

  • Daymar College Bowling Green is 108.9% more expensive to attend than Lander University for in-state tuition ($22,348.00 vs. $10,700.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 10.1% higher at Daymar College-Bowling Green than Lander University ($22,348.00 vs. $20,300.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Lander University than Daymar College-Bowling Green ($15,524 vs. $28,083)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Daymar College Bowling Green are 50.5% lower than costs at Lander University ($7,110 vs. $10,700)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Lander University than Daymar College Bowling Green (98% vs. 73%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Lander University students is 130.4% larger than aid received Daymar College Bowling Green ($10,763 vs. $4,672)

Lander University vs. Daymar College-Bowling Green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Lander University or Daymar College-Bowling Green?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Daymar College-Bowling Green and Lander University.

  • Graduates from Lander University earn on average $12,400 more per year than Daymar College-Bowling Green graduates after ten years. ($37,000 vs. $24,600)
  • Daymar College Bowling Green students graduate with a $8,006 lower median federal student loan debt than Lander University graduates. ($18,994 vs. $27,000)
  • Daymar College-Bowling Green graduates are paying $83 less per month on federal student loans than Lander University graduates. ($196 vs. $279)
  • More Lander University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Daymar College-Bowling Green students, three years after graduation. (46% vs. 18%)
